Fold-up pushchairs make it simple to hop on and off public transport or fit into the back of cars. They are also extremely compact and lightweight, making them ideal for travel by plane.

This UPPAbaby has one of the most compact folds we've ever seen. It has a few limitations, such as a small canopy, and there's no storage.

Folding Ease

Consider the location and how you'll use the pushchair prior to deciding on one. If you're traveling with your child on planes or train, a lightweight and compact buggy is an ideal choice. It can fit into the overhead luggage compartments and is small enough to be carried over the shoulder. Find an easy-to-use fold that's simple to operate while holding your baby and a handle that can be adjusted to height so parents and carers of different heights can enjoy it comfortably. A swivel lock wheel is essential if you intend to hike with your child. It will help you navigate through uneven terrain. Look for features like a deep recline to allow the baby to sleep comfortably while on the move, and an extendable sun canopy.

Many pushchairs claim to be able to be folded in one-hand but it's important to test this before you buy to ensure it's actually possible while holding your child. The UPPAbaby G Luxe was rated highly by our test participants, due to its clever mechanism which concertinas into a package that is smaller than an umbrella. It also has a convenient pocket to store keys and phone and an easy recline seat that's ideal for children who like to sleep on the move.

Some of the most compact fold-up pushchairs are made to be used right from birth, and include a lie-flat seat or the option of an additional carrycot, so they're ideal for young babies who need to sleep throughout the daytime. If you intend to use your travel system from the beginning, a one-click attachment system for an infant car seat is also an essential feature.

The smallest of the bunch that's the Cybex Libelle, is an ideal choice for families who travel because it folds smaller than the YOYO2 (only 4cm smaller) and weighs less at under 6kg so is very easy to carry. It is also simple to use using a single hand fold, and the seat reclines to accommodate toddler napping. This model is also a great option for hikers as it has an oversized front swivel wheel that can tackle any terrain.

One-Handed folding

If you're taking a stroll in the park, whizzing around the city on public transport, or heading to distant shores with your baby it's important to have a pushchair that folds up easily. It's not a good idea to fold a complicated travel system and manage the child and all their necessities, including keys, shopping bags and other things. This is the reason why one-handed strollers and pushchairs are the most sought-after option for parents.

One-handed fold pushchairs can be folded by pressing the button or buttons. Some models require a bit more effort or even two hands, but the convenience of the process makes them nevertheless easy to maneuver and stow away. They also tend to be lighter, making them simpler to carry around and fit in small spaces.

A good example is the G-Luxe from UPPAbaby. This model is among the easiest to fold with one hand in our roundup. It's all it takes is pulling a lever on the chassis. It can also stand up on its own, making it perfect for storing in the corner of a café or foyer.

The Bugaboo Bee is another model that folds by one hand. It is one of the first pushchairs that fold compactly. Although it is larger than other options the Bugaboo Bee still has an easy to use, neat fold. It's got a variety of features, such as a deep recline and an expandable UPF 50+ canopy designed to keep your little one protected on sunny days.

Some of these compact-folded pushchairs from birth are designed specifically for older babies and toddlers. However, there are more options that can be used starting from the time of birth. These pushchairs have seats that can be fully or partially lied-flat, and some even come with a baby car seat. MFM editor Gemma has traveled extensively with her son in the Babyzen YOYO, which is one of the first buggys of this type and still a firm favourite. It's smaller than other buggy models, but is still easy to handle. It can be incorporated into the baggage allowances for cabin baggage on many airlines.

Lightweight

A pushchair that folds is typically very compact and light. This is particularly applicable to umbrella-folded pushchairs that weigh less than 20 pounds. They're ideal for short strolls on flat surfaces and pavements and for a quick transfer between your vehicle and the homes of others. They're also a good choice for those who don't want to purchase an all-terrain buggy but are content with your pushchair on flat surfaces.

If you want to fold a compact black pushchair on uneven ground or on muddy or sand surfaces, consider getting an air-filled tyre. These tyres are more heavy and provide greater grip and traction. It's important to note that the extra weight will add to the size of your pushchair.

A variety of lightweight pushchairs were created for older toddlers and infants who can sit independently, but more are now suitable from birth. These include models like the Mamas & Papas Airo, with a lie-flat seat and the option of adding an additional carrycot pack (sold separately) or an infant car seat to make a travel system. Some compact-fold pushchairs are even designed to be used with a stroller board, transforming them into a double buggy. great for taking Grandma or Grandad along too.

A majority of the best lightweight strollers are easy to use. Some pushchairs can be opened or closed by pressing one button. Others have more complex mechanisms, yet they require little space. Some pushchairs come with wristbands that allow users to hold the pushchair even when it's folded. This can make it easier to move.

While some lightweight pushchairs can be extremely basic, the 3D Lite from Contours is an excellent example of how a tiny stroller can come with a wealth of features. There's also a substantial basket, lots of padding and adjustable handlebars (for parents who are tall or short) and a massive protective canopy. It's also very lightweight and comes with a handy bag.

Compact

When choosing a stroller, you should think about how compact it is when folded. Some models have a tiny fold while others are larger, dependent on their overall size and the features they have.

It is also essential to be compact for those who plan to travel with your stroller. There are models that fold to the smallest size, and even into a pouch, which means they can be easily stashed away in the boot of a car, or taken on an airplane as baggage for cabin use. If you are planning to travel frequently or in a place where you can't use a large stroller on a daily basis it is the best solution for you.

The best pushchairs are those that have a simple, easy-to-fold process. The Babyzen YOYO was the first of its kind and has since been imitated however it stands out thanks to its clever details and superior functionality.

The Babyzen YOYO is ideal for travel because it has folds that are incredibly small and only slightly larger than the majority of hand luggage allowances. It can be used at the airport between the flight's departure and landing it.
